#0c78b8 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0c78b8 is composed of 4.7% red, 47.1% green and 72.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 93.5% cyan, 34.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 27.8% black. It has a hue angle of 202.3 degrees, a saturation of 87.8% and a lightness of 38.4%. #0c78b8 color hex could be obtained by blending #18f0ff with #000071. Closest websafe color is: #0066cc.

Shades and Tints of #0c78b8

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010c12 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#0c78b8

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5f6365 is the less saturated color, while #047ac0 is the most saturated one.
